Super User M24 Differential Gauge Bellows Type Differential Pressure Gauge The Budenberg model M24 range of Differential Pressure Gauges have been designed for applications that require the measurement of low differential pressures whilst accommodating very high static pressures. It has been designed around a balanced bellows system, which converts the differential pressure into a rotary movement by way of a torsion tube assembly and mechanical linkages. The entire assembly is liquid filled, producing a hydraulic self lubricating measurement system which allows for full line pressure to be applied to either side of the unit without damage to the device. Standard Connection 1/2" x 1/2" BSP (P) Female 1/2" x 1/2" NPT Female Overload The unit will withstand the maximum line pressure to either side of the unit and up to 750 Bar static pressure. Pressure Element Brass / Bronze 75 mBar to 7.6 Bar differential pressure 316 Stainless Steel 150 mBar to 27.5 Bar differential pressure Inconel / St St 150 mBar to 69 Bar differential pressure Option: Other bellows materials are available, including Hastelloy Accuracy Class ±0.75% FSD on ranges up to 1 Bar differential ±1.00% FSD on ranges from 1 to 30 Bar differential ±1.50% FSD on ranges from 31 to 69 Bar differential Temperature Effect Operating: -40 to +200°c Storage: -50 to +250°c Environmental IP55 as defined in EN 60 529 Equalising Valves Budenberg recoomends the use of needle type isolating or equalising valves for use with this instrument, as quick operating valves can cause harmful pressure surges. Certification Available BS EN 10204 3.1B certification. Point by Point Test certificate. Safety All units are manufactured to comply with EN837-1. All cases are fitted with a blow-out vent. model M24 Gauge Dial Specifications Size M24-2 100mm (4") M24-6 150mm (6") Dial White Anodised Aluminium marked in black Single or Dual Scale Pointer Black Micro Adjustable Knife Edge Pointer Movement 316L Stainless Steel Construction Option: Viscous damped movement to overcome the effects of minor pressure pulsations.
